Abstract
ON November 3, 1931, during a trawling survey of Falkland Island waters, the R.R.S. William Scoresby made a haul with a commercial trawl in 98 m. of water on a position 45° 56 S′., 66° 24′ W. situated in the Gulf of San Jorge, off the Patagonian coast.
